Parasyu is an enemy from Mega Man 3. It is a circus robot with a parachute on its back.

Parasyu was first made available in the devkit for the original Make a Good Mega Man Level contest. It didn't appear in any entries, but it did appear in the Wily stages SnoruntPyro's Stage and the Final Stage.

Parasyu returned in Make a Good Mega Man Level 2, where it appeared in the entries Cardinal Man, SMB3, and Ruined Lab, as well as the Pit of Pits mini-stage "Beach Party".

Behavior

Parasyus will fall down from the top of the screen when Mega Man is close enough to them. When they reach a specific position (the position they were placed internally), they will open their parachutes and begin floating down slowly, swaying back and forth.
